How Our Carpet Water Extraction Process Works in Prescott Valley, AZ
The process of carpet water extraction may seem straightforward, but it needs a specific sequence of steps to ensure that your carpet is properly cleaned and dried. Our team follows a strict process to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ough cleanup. We’ll start by inspecting the affected area to identify the source of the water and assess the extent of the damage. From there, we’ll extract the water using specialized equipment, followed by a thorough cleaning and drying process to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will inspect the affected area to identify the source of the water and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ll check for any signs of structural damage or hidden water pockets that could lead to further problems if not addressed.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our team will extract the water from your carpet. We’ll use a combination of wet vacuums and pumps to remove as much water as possible re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Cleaning and Drying
Once the water has been extracted, our team will thoroughly clean and dry your carpet.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any dirt, grime, or debris that may have been left behind by the water.
Step 4: Drying and Monitoring
Finally, our team will monitor the drying process to ensure that your carpet is completely dry and free of moisture. We’ll use specialized equipment to check for any signs of moisture or humidity that could lead to further problems if not addressed.

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on carpet | Yes | No | You can likely clean it up yourself with a wet vacuum and some cleaning solutions. |
| Large water spill on carpet | No | Yes | Our team has the equipment and expertise to extract the water quickly and efficiently, reducing the risk of further damage. |
| Water damage to carpet and underlying flooring | No | Yes | Our team can help you repair or replace the flooring to prevent further problems. |
| Musty odors or mildew growth | No | Yes |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to get rid of it.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| Our team can help you repair or replace the flooring to prevent further problems. |

Carpet Water Extraction Cost in Prescott Valley, AZ
The cost of carpet water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Prescott Valley, AZ. Our team will provide a free estimate and walk you through the costs.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Carpet water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Carpet cleaning and drying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of cleaning solution used |
| Underlayment replacement |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of underlayment, and local conditions |
| Carpet repl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of carpet, and local conditions |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and local conditions |

Common Questions About Carpet Water Extraction
Q: How long does carpet water extraction take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ete carpet water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a timeline and keep you informed throughout the process. On average,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ete the extraction and drying process.
Q: Can I use a wet vacuum to extract water from my carpet?
A: While a wet vacuum can be used to extract some water from your carpet, it may not be enough to remove all of the water, especially if the damage is extensive. Our team uses specialized equipment to extract water quickly and efficiently re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.
Q: How do I prevent mold and mildew growth after carpet water extraction?
A: To prevent mold and mildew growth after carpet water extraction, it’s essential to ensure that the carpet is completely dry and free of moisture. Our team will use specialized equipment to check for any signs of moisture or humidity that could lead to further problems if not addressed.
